WebGiven a graph G and an integer k, the Interval Vertex Deletion (IVD) problem asks whether there exists a subset S⊆ V(G) of size at most k such that G-S is an interval graph. This problem is known to be NP-complete (according to Yannakakis at STOC 1978).Originally in 2012, Cao and Marx showed that IVD is fixed parameter tractable: they exhibited an … WebJun 6, 2011 · Now I should realize vertex deletion.
